Abstract
The present invention relates to a multi-coil wireless charging method and a device and a system therefor, a wireless power transmitter for wirelessly transmitting power to a wireless power receiver, according to one embodiment of the present invention, comprising: a power transmission unit which comprises at least two or more transmission coils; a control unit which controls so that a primary detection signal for detecting the existence of a wireless power receiver is simultaneously transmitted by using frequencies that are different from each other that were allocated to each of the transmission coils in advance; and a demodulation unit which, if a first signal strength indicator associated with the primary detection signal is received from the wireless power receiver, transmits, to the control unit, the received first signal strength indicator and a preset transmission coil identifier for identifying the transmission coil through which the first signal strength indicator was received, wherein the control unit may control so that a secondary detection signal is transmitted through the transmission coil through which the first signal strength indicator was received. Thus, the present invention has a merit of enabling a quicker and more accurate detection of a wireless power receiver.
